Professor of History Heather Cox Richardson served as a consultant for the "American Experience" program on President James Garfield that premiered February 2 on PBS. "Murder of a President" tells the story of Garfield's unprecedented rise to power, the shooting by Charles Guiteau only four months into his presidency and its bizarre and heartbreaking aftermath.

An expert in 19th-century American history, Richardson reviewed the script for historical accuracy and helped to provide political context. She also offers on-air commentary.

Richardson is the author of several books, including To Make Men Free: A History of the Republican Party; Wounded Knee: Party Politics and the Road to an American Massacre, and West from Appomattox: The Reconstruction of America after the Civil War, among others.
